About Bayswater 3153

The size of Bayswater is approximately 7.9 square kilometres. It has 17 parks covering nearly 4.5% of total area. The population of Bayswater in 2016 was 11758 people. By 2021 the population was 12262 showing a population growth of 4.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bayswater is 30-39 years. Households in Bayswater are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bayswater work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 63.40% of the homes in Bayswater were owner-occupied compared with 65.30% in 2016.

Bayswater has 9,120 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Bayswater have seen a 28.94%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 20.39% increase. As at 31 January 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Bayswater is $939,796 while the median value for Units is $682,263.
  • Houses have a median rent of $590 while Units have a median rent of $550.
